If memory serves me right, mewtwo has base 130 speed, very high. Especially on a timid one with perfect ivs, which judging by the low special attack this guy listed for the mewtwo, this one does not have.
A non speed nature mewtwo will have trouble keeping up with a proper jolly weavile, or a timid gengar. I Think Starmie's faster than that too with a speed nature.
So it's totally possible. Really the wayy to defeat me first are so varied one should be able to handle it on a case by case basis with a relatively diverse team.

pikachu65 wrote: yas thats the one, where can I get it?
Choice Specs can be obtained from the house in Celestic Town that acts as the PokéMart. A man gives it to you. Available between the times of 4:00 am and 9:59 am.
